DSF/prEN ISO 28139
Agricultural and forestry machinery - Knapsack combustion engine driven mistblowers - Safety requirements (ISO/DIS 28139:2007)

scope:
This International Standard specifies the safety requirements and their verification for the design and
construction of knapsack mistblowers incorporating a combustion engine.
It describes methods for the elimination or reduction of hazards arising from their use. In addition, it specifies the type of information on safe working practices to be provided by the manufacturer. It does not however give any technical requirement to reduce noise and vibration hazards. Indeed the different means available to reduce these hazards are a matter for the technical aids to which the manufacturer may resort, through specialized books or specified bodies.
This International Standard deals with all the significant hazards, hazardous situations and events excepting environmental hazards and hazards arising from electromagnetic compatibility, noise and vibrations relevant to knapsack combustion engine driven mistblowers, when they are used as intended and under the conditions foreseen by the manufacturer (see Clause 4).
This International Standard is not applicable to knapsack combustion engine driven mistblowers which are manufactured before the date of this document by ISO.
